2016-06-06 24 views
0

Я использую botkit, и я пытаюсь получить хранилище, работающее через firebase.Аутентифицировать firebase с модулем botkit-storage-firebase

Я использую botkit-хранения-firebase модуль: https://github.com/howdyai/botkit-storage-firebase

Однако, когда я пытаюсь сохранить что-нибудь (или получить что-нибудь), я получаю Permission denied от Firebase

controller.storage.users.save({ id: 'words', words: response.words }); 

Я имел устанавливать правила безопасности базы данных для:

{ 
"rules": { 
    ".read": true, 
    ".write": true 
} 
} 

чтобы быть в состоянии использовать это, однако, оставив свою базу без безопасности, очевидно, не то, что Я хочу.

Как проверить подлинность с помощью Firebase с помощью модуля botkit-storage-firebase?

ответ

1

Я столкнулся с тем же вопросом, что и с Боткитом и Firebase. Оказывается, botkit-storage-firebase использует Firebase 2.0, который несовместим с текущей версией. Я нашел запрос на растяжение, который еще не был объединен, и использовал этот репо, и теперь все работает плавно. Возможно, вы также можете изменить свои правила безопасности.

У этой ссылки есть ссылка на fork- https://github.com/esjay/botkit-storage-firebase

Смежные вопросы